Handover for the Pinfold address autocomplete widget. Debounce is 250ms; the suggestion cache invalidates nightly. Watch the Karsten locale fallback — it silently swaps to the default region list if the feed is stale. Tests live alongside the widget, not in the main suite. The service account for the suggestion feed can be restored with the recovery passphrase that follows.

vault phrase of tajop-haduf = holath-brivan-wenax

This PR reworks the Tallbridge fleet fuel-usage report to aggregate per-depot rather than per-vehicle, fixing the double-counting seen in the Ashgrove rollout. All figures were cross-checked against last quarter's manual audit. Please review the smoothing and outlier thresholds carefully, as they directly affect the published numbers.

constants for fawep-yagap:
QUOTAS = {
    "noveth": 275,
    "oliion": 740,
}

MEMO — Records Team

The Herslow mantel clock from the Varnick Hall lobby was collected today for repair at Quillon & Daughters Horology in Brastead. The movement will be cleaned and the chime realigned; estimated turnaround is three weeks. Please log the outbound transfer under the fixtures register and retain the signed condition report. For the return leg, the following applies to the courier hand-over.

courier memo of yawep-yafog: the pramir ulaix courier leaves the ulavan aldix frair zorok oliiel joreth rusdor fenvan ledger at gate 1305 under passcode 514738

Context for plugin authors consuming the Fernwhistle gateway: we added a circuit breaker in front of the upstream Tallowgrid API last sprint. When the failure rate crosses the threshold, the breaker opens and your plugin calls receive a fast 503 with a retry-after hint rather than hanging. Half-open probes resume automatically; do not implement your own retry storm on top. Everything is tunable per plugin namespace, and defaults are conservative. The breaker settings currently shipped in staging and production are listed below.

deployment values, bafog-tajop:
NOVAEL_PIN=7103
NOVAEL_TENANT=weneth
NOVAEL_METRICS_HOST=metrics.novael.crelvocorp.corp
NOVAEL_SEAL=seal_be72a3d3
NOVAEL_STANDBY_TEAM=caseth